What Are Home Loans?


Home loans, also known as mortgages, are financial instruments that enable individuals to purchase or refinance properties without having to pay the full price upfront. In essence, they are a long-term loan provided by banks, credit unions, or mortgage lenders, with the property itself serving as collateral. Home loans come in various forms, but the two most common types are fixed-rate and adjustable-rate mortgages.


### Fixed-Rate Mortgages


A **fixed-rate mortgage** is characterized by a consistent interest rate throughout the loan term, typically ranging from 15 to 30 years. This means that your monthly payments remain steady, providing financial predictability and stability. Fixed-rate mortgages are ideal for those who prefer a consistent budget and want protection from rising interest rates.


### Adjustable-Rate Mortgages


**Adjustable-rate mortgages (ARMs)**, on the other hand, offer a variable interest rate that fluctuates periodically based on prevailing market conditions. While initial rates may be lower than those of fixed-rate mortgages, they can rise over time, potentially leading to higher monthly payments. ARMs can be advantageous if you plan to sell your property or refinance before the adjustable rate period begins.


## The Home Loan Application Process


Securing a home loan involves several critical steps. Let's walk you through the process to ensure a smooth journey:


### 1. Prequalification


Before you start house hunting, it's wise to get **prequalified** for a home loan. This initial step helps you determine how much you can afford and what type of loan suits your financial situation. Lenders will evaluate your income, credit score, and debt-to-income ratio during this stage.


### 2. Mortgage Preapproval


A **mortgage preapproval** takes prequalification a step further. Here, lenders conduct a thorough examination of your financial history and creditworthiness. Being preapproved gives you a competitive advantage when making offers on properties, as it shows sellers that you are a serious and qualified buyer.


### 3. Loan Application


Once you've found your dream home, you can proceed with the formal **loan application**. You'll need to provide detailed information about your finances, employment, and the property you intend to purchase. The lender will review your application and may request additional documentation.


### 4. Underwriting


During the **underwriting** phase, the lender assesses your application, verifying the information provided. They will also conduct an appraisal of the property to ensure its value aligns with the loan amount. This step is crucial in determining whether your loan will be approved.


### 5. Loan Approval


Upon successful underwriting, you will receive the coveted **loan approval**. This means that the lender has committed to funding your home purchase. At this point, you can finalize the details of your loan, including the interest rate and closing costs.


### 6. Closing


The final step in the home loan process is the **closing**. This is where all necessary documents are signed, and the property officially changes ownership. You'll be required to pay closing costs, which can include fees for appraisals, title searches, and insurance.


## Types of Home Loan Programs


Now that you understand the application process, let's explore some common **home loan programs** available to borrowers:


### 1. Conventional Loans


**Conventional loans** are the most traditional type of home loan, not backed by any government agency. They typically require a higher credit score and a larger down payment but offer competitive interest rates.


### 2. FHA Loans


**FHA loans**, insured by the Federal Housing Administration, are designed for first-time homebuyers and those with lower credit scores. They require a smaller down payment but come with mortgage insurance premiums.


### 3. VA Loans


**VA loans**, guaranteed by the Department of Veterans Affairs, are exclusively available to eligible veterans and active-duty service members. These loans offer favorable terms, including no down payment requirements.


### 4. USDA Loans


**USDA loans** are aimed at rural and suburban homebuyers who meet income requirements. They offer zero-down financing for eligible properties in designated areas.


## Managing Your Home Loan


Once you've secured a home loan, it's essential to manage it effectively to ensure financial stability and avoid potential pitfalls:


### 1. Budget Wisely


Create a **budget** that accounts for your monthly mortgage payments, property taxes, insurance, and maintenance costs. Sticking to a well-defined budget will help you avoid financial stress.


### 2. Maintain Good Credit


Your **credit score** plays a crucial role in your ability to secure favorable loan terms. Pay your bills on time, reduce credit card debt, and avoid opening new lines of credit to maintain a healthy credit profile.


### 3. Refinancing Options


Keep an eye on **refinancing** opportunities, especially when interest rates drop. Refinancing can lower your monthly payments and save you money over the life of your loan.


### 4. Seek Professional Advice


Consider consulting a **financial advisor** or mortgage specialist to navigate complex financial decisions related to your home loan.
